Industrial and High-Risk Perimeter Security

For heavy industry, data centres, and logistics hubs, basic chain-link fencing is entirely insufficient. Facilities managers must engage specialised industrial property perimeter fence contractors who understand the necessity of robust, tamper-proof boundaries.

  • Steel Palisade: This remains a staple for UK industrial estates due to its imposing visual deterrent. Procurement teams often seek out dedicated commercial steel palisade fencing contractors to install these rigid, W-section or D-section profiles, which are exceptionally difficult to cut or bend.

  • High-Security Mesh: For sites requiring both high visibility (for CCTV integration) and extreme cut-resistance, businesses turn to a heavy duty mesh fencing company. Products like 358 welded mesh (Prison Mesh) are heavily utilized to prevent finger-and-toe holds.

  • Anti-Climb Innovations: To fortify vulnerable borders, it is highly recommended to source materials directly from anti climb security fence manufacturers. These producers supply specialised cranked toppings, rotating spikes (like Vanguard or Razor Wire), and closely welded mesh panels that completely neutralize scaling attempts.

  • Integrated Gate Systems: A fence is only as secure as its access points. Securing expert commercial gate and fence installation services guarantees that heavy-duty sliding cantilevers, automated bi-folding gates, and pedestrian turnstiles are integrated flawlessly with the primary fencing line and your company's existing access control software.

Specialized Commercial Fencing: Education, Sports, and Environment

Beyond heavy industry, several sectors require highly specialized boundary solutions that balance safety, durability, and aesthetics.

  • Education Sector: Ensuring student safety is a strict legal requirement for academy trusts and local authorities. Engaging certified school playground fencing installers uk ensures that boundaries are free from sharp edges, finger traps, and conform entirely to RoSPA (Royal Society for the Prevention of Accidents) guidelines. Bow-top railings and colourful V-mesh panels are standard in this sector.

  • Acoustic Control: Manufacturing plants, busy distribution centres, and roadside commercial developments face strict noise pollution regulations. To comply with local environmental health standards, businesses must partner with acoustic fencing suppliers commercial wholesale who can provide tested, timber or composite sound-reflective and sound-absorptive barriers.

  • Sports and Leisure: From 5-a-side football arenas to professional tennis courts, sports facilities require specialized high-impact boundaries. Working with expert corporate sports pitch fencing providers ensures the installation of twin-wire mesh systems equipped with neoprene dampeners to reduce noise from ball impacts, alongside integrated goal recesses and spectator rails.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the difference between V-mesh and 358 Prison Mesh fencing?

V-mesh (or profile mesh) features distinct "V" shaped folds pressed into the panels to provide rigidity without adding excessive weight or cost, making it ideal for retail parks, schools, and general commercial boundaries. In contrast, 358 mesh (Prison Mesh) features incredibly tight weld spacings (3 inches x 0.5 inches) made from heavy-gauge wire (8 gauge). This prevents intruders from gaining a finger or toe hold to climb the fence, and the gaps are too small for standard bolt cutters to penetrate, making it the standard for high-security environments like data centres and utility plants.

Do I need planning permission to install a commercial fence in the UK?

Generally, under UK permitted development rights, you do not need planning permission if the commercial fence is less than 2 metres high (or less than 1 metre high if it is situated adjacent to a highway used by vehicles). However, if your premises are located in a conservation area, adjacent to a listed building, or if you are exceeding the 2-metre height limit (which is standard for high-security industrial palisade or mesh), you must apply for planning permission from your local council before contracting an installer.

What is LPS 1175, and why is it important for B2B perimeter security?

LPS 1175 is an internationally recognized certification issued by the LPCB (Loss Prevention Certification Board) that tests and grades the resistance of physical security products against forced entry. For high-risk commercial sites, insurance companies often mandate the use of LPS 1175 certified fencing.

The rating dictates how long the fence can withstand an attack using specific toolsets (e.g., an SR1 rating guarantees resistance against opportunist attacks using basic hand tools, while SR4 or higher resists sustained attacks using heavy power tools).
